Trained in the studios of Alexandre Cabanel and Jean-Léon Gérôme Dagnan-Bouveret received the second Prix de Rome. Of naturalist inspiration he devoted himself to religious painting and had a prolific career as a portraitist at the end of his life. He received prestigious commissions from the Countess of Béarn and the New York Frick family. unknown

Blaise Pascal was a French mathematician physicist and philosopher who began writing works on theology and philosophy after a religious experience in 1654. His 'Lettres provinciales' were a series of letters written during the formulary controversy between the Jansenists and the Jesuits. In his letters Pascal defends the Jansenist Antoine Arnauld who was condemned for his 'heretical' views. Arnauld was also a friend of Pascal. With a bookseller's label for 'P.
